The hotel is nothing like the pictures shown inthe hotels.com app. It is very run down. The sheets and beds were clean. Neither time we went to the pool was the pump on. Breakfast was waffle, bread for toast, donuts from a bag, or cereal and coffee was in small cups. They locked one of the lobby doors to keep you from taking food to your room. VERY DISAPPOINTED for Quality Inn

Unsafe!!!
When we arrived, there was NO ONE around. The office was dark with a single light on in the back rooms. Wasn’t even sure it was open. When checked the door, it was unlocked. Went in and called out several times saying hello is anyone here? Took a whole 3 to 4 minutes for anyone to respond. When he did come up to the desk, I told him that I had reserved on hotels.com for a handicap accessible room, and he immediately wanted my credit card and said that he did not see where it said handicap accessible request. Not to argue with him, I told him that as long as it was wheelchair friendly meaning that my husband could get around in a wheelchair in the room and was close to an elevator or on the first floor. It should be fine. He assured me that everything was good to go and told me not to put the key next to the phone because it would deactivate the room key. We drove around the building to where our room was located in immediately noticed that there was a broken fence right across from our room. I let that go thinking that maybe there has been a recent accident and they hadn’t had time to fix it yet. However, when we went into the room and tried to close the door, it would not close…it kept bouncing back at us. I tried to engage the bolt and the bolt would not engage. I looked up and saw that the door had been dented in and the chain lock had been removed. We immediately decided that we did not feel safe there as we have a two year-old daughter. We checked out.

The “breakfast” consists of waffles, bread and cereal with milk and terrible coffee. My boys were hungry. They do not eat waffles… Even cheese sandwiches would be better. The property itself is old and very “tired”. They charge you extra $10 even if you paid the whole price ahead.
